Abstract

The results showed that professionalism, competence, and training positively and significantly affected employee performance. This study proves and accepts a positive and significant influence between competency professionalism on employee performance, which is mediated by education and training variables within the Makassar Class I Correctional Center. This means that it shows that the more professionalism, competence, and education and training within the Makassar Class I Correctional Center are improved with the policy components carried out by organizational leaders, the higher the performance that employees can produce. Because in principle, the leadership policies implemented by an organization are structured to improve the performance of their employees and then impact organizational performance because employees are the most vital resource that will determine the organization's success in the organization's goals work program.
